Restoration Panel~
~Completed for Historic Etz Mansion c 1897, Wheeling WV
- Window removal from original sash & glass removal from frame.
 - In order to reach broken piece, the zinc colonial came needed to be de-soldered.
 - Color selection for broken piece. Visited Wissmach Glass Works in order to attempt a color match.
 - Shadow drawing of original piece size utilized in order to cut, shape and fit the piece accurately.
 - Re-soldering of original joints.
 - Re-cementing of entire piece, complete with new glazing upon placement in frame.
 - Black patina added to new solder joints to blend with historic came color.
 - Re-installation in house.
